import datetime as dt from airflow.utils.log.logging_mixin import LoggingMixin import pandas as pd __all__ = ["Interpolator"] class Interpolator(LoggingMixin): @staticmethod def interpolate_series( start_date: dt.datetime, end_date: dt.datetime, dates: list[dt.datetime], values: list[int], historical_date: dt.datetime | None = None, historical_value: int | None = None, ) -> list[int]: series = pd.Series(data=values, index=pd.DatetimeIndex(dates)) if dates[0] > start_date and historical_date is not None and historical_value is not None: # if there is something to fill at tail, and we have historical value interpolation_start_date = historical_date historical_series = pd.Series(data=(historical_value,), index=pd.DatetimeIndex((historical_date,))) series = pd.concat((historical_series, series)) else: interpolation_start_date = dates[0] series = series.reindex(pd.date_range(interpolation_start_date, end_date, freq="D")) # fill head with last known value series = series.interpolate(method="ffill", limit_area="outside") # interpolate everything else series = series.interpolate(method="time", limit_area="inside") # take only integer part series = series.astype("ulonglong") # Take only dates in the range # https://github.com/python/mypy/issues/2410 series = series[start_date:] # type: ignore return series.tolist()
